Power of attorney

Lasting power of attorney, or more commonly referred to as power of attorney, is a document which allows you to elect a trusted family member of friend to make legal decisions on your behalf. This can be especially useful for the future when you may lack the mental capacity to make informed decisions. We can advise you about personal welfare powers of attorney or property and affairs powers of attorney.
